According to reports, the Washington C.H. Police Department responded to the following calls:

April 24

Assault: At 3:13 p.m., officers responded to the 300 block of East East Street on reports of a male in a blue Nissan Altima allegedly punching his girlfriend. Officers later spoke with the victim, ,who advised that an argument had ensued and her boyfriend backhanded her with a closed fist while driving. The victim sustained a laceration to her eye, along with swelling. The offender, identified as Christopher John Burnett, 43, was located and subsequently arrested for first-degree misdemeanor assault.

Violation of Protection Order: At 7:49 p.m., an officer observed the victim and alleged offender in the same vehicle together. The officer ran a wants and warrants check on the offender and learned he was the respondent in a protection order against the victim who was in the vehicle. The officer made contact with the offender, identified as Richard Dontay Rickman, 41, and he was arrested for fifth-degree felony violation of a protection order.

April 21

Possession of Drugs/Possession of Drug Paraphernalia: At 4:01 p.m. while on a traffic stop, officers made contact with a female who had active warrants. After being arrested, officers located suspected drugs and drug paraphernalia.
